Tiller has committed to play for Missouri for the 2026-27 season, per Jeff Borzello of ESPN.com. Analysis: Tiller will join the Tigers following a single season with Kansas. The 6-foot-11 forward has averaged 7.9 points and 6.1 rebounds per game across 35 contests for the Jayhawks this past season. He will retain three years of eligibility with Missouri moving forward.
